Pet Shop Boys' 2011 release, The Most Incredible Thing, is a captivating score for the ballet of the same name, based on the 1870 fairy tale by Hans Christian Andersen. This enchanting album, composed by Neil Tennant and Chris Lowe, showcases the duo's signature synthpop and new wave styles. Featuring 21 tracks, including 'Prologue', 'The Grind', and 'The Miracle - Ceremony', the album takes the listener on a mesmerising journey through the world of ballet.
Performed by Pet Shop Boys with the Wrocław Score Orchestra, conducted by Dominic Wheeler, The Most Incredible Thing is a masterful blend of electronic and orchestral elements. The album was released on 14 March 2011 by Parlophone, with an exclusive, limited art edition following in May 2011. With a duration of 1 hour and 23 minutes, this double-CD release is a must-have for fans of Pet Shop Boys and ballet alike.
